The property was wonderful - great views to the olive trees and the sea. Very quiet (if you don't mind the sounds of nature; but since you're looking at a property in a countryside, you most likely don't). It was 32+ degrees Celsius (90F) when we visited at the end of June, thus the pool was a real blessing. Yes, there were some bugs in it, but then again - don't expect anything else from an open-air pool. Since we only booked a few days in advance, we got the smallest room, I believe, but it was by far not small - we had plenty space to walk around the bed even with two suitcases lying on the floor (we did not use the wardrobe since we only stayed for two nights). Upon arrival, we found ants on the bathroom window sill. Very polite ants, I must say, since they wee all gone when we got back from dinner and did not get back the next day! :D The sound insulation of the room leaves to be desired - you can hear when your neighbors are coming back and leaving (so you might want to pack in some earplugs), but that's if you really picky. The room was great. The restaurant - even better. The food (both breakfast and dinner) was tasty, the staff very friendly. Since we book for two nights, but due to our rental breakdown were only able to arrive the next day (and booked one extra night since we loved the place), they charged us only for two nights instead of three, which was hugely appreciated. We will definitely come back!

Wow wow wow is all I can say about this property, the owner Alessandro and the team. Phenomenal grounds. Cosy, super clean rooms (just a few ants) - but we are in a Masseria, modern key access and on site parking. 6 mins drive from the bustling Otranto. As vegetarians, they tried to accommodate us with more non meat breakfast options. Dinner for those who eat meat and fish - you must try it. Even for my sister and I, they created a 2 course meal for our final night which was delicious. Alessandro takes care of his guests, and I’m grateful he and his team went out of their way to organise a bottle of Prosecco and a cake with candle for my sisters birthday. I would highly recommend this hotel. it’s also close to the most beautiful beaches. PS the tennis court was a massive bonus. Minor Drawbacks: - better signage leading to the Masseria. the lights are not enough. - breakfast to finish at 1030am had to keep the tea/ coffee until the last guest leaves. - ants in the room and travelled into the suitcase. if you are going to Otranto, you MUST stay here !!
